The facilities at Clapham (North Yorkshire) are straightforward, reflecting its rural character. There is no ticket office or ticket machine available, so travelers are advised to purchase tickets in advance or rely on alternative purchase methods when planning their journeys. An induction loop is present for enhanced accessibility for those with hearing impairments. Although the station is categorized as having partial step-free access (Category B), travelers should note that there is no wheelchair access to the Lancaster-bound platform due to a footbridge. Nevertheless, the Leeds-bound platform is easily reachable via level access.
While waiting areas and 1st Class Lounges are absent, the station provides a car park operated by Northern with 12 spaces. It remains accessible 24 hours a day throughout the week, free of charge. Cyclists are supported with 10 sheltered bicycle storage spaces on Platform 1, complete with CCTV security.
To complement your rail journey, Clapham offers a limited range of onward travel options. Taxis can be arranged, providing easy links to your next destination through services such as Cab4You. An absence of nearby bus services necessitates consultation with Busline for the best connections—indicating a station more suited to travelers using personal or hired transportation. For those who might need it, rail replacement services can be accessed from the station car park with suitable transport.

Dumfries station is well-equipped to meet the needs of its passengers. Open year-round with a ticket office accessible every day and ticket machines available for convenience, it's never been easier to collect your tickets. The station ensures accessibility with step-free access throughout, induction loops, and accessible toilets, making it a user-friendly spot for all passengers.
For those seeking assistance, staff are available almost around the clock, happy to help from early morning until midnight on weekdays and Saturdays. Waiting rooms are cozy and feature waiting facilities on each platform, available from 06:35 to 19:30. The station's car park is spacious, offering 134 spaces, including accessible parking. This parking lot is monitored by CCTV, ensuring security for your vehicle.
Navigating the next leg of your journey is a breeze thanks to the transport connections at Dumfries station. Taxis are easily hired, and for those planning longer explorations, Glenrental car hire is conveniently located on Platform 2. If buses are your preference, local services can be accessed through the car park, detailed on Travel Line Scotland's website, or by calling their 24-hour number. For those unexpected disruptions, there are also rail replacement services with pickups from the station car park.
